    Join Thriveworks as a Psychiatric Mental Health Nurse Practitioner in South Carolina!

    At Thriveworks, our commitment to delivering safe and effective care via telemedicine drives our approach. While we offer stimulant medications when appropriate, we prioritize individualized treatment plans based on each client’s unique symptoms and diagnoses, allowing our clinicians the discretion to make informed choices. Please note that we currently do not treat substance use disorders, and we carefully refer clients to in-person providers for more complex issues that cannot be addressed solely through telehealth.

    As a Thriveworks Nurse Practitioner, you will provide compassionate care to a diverse clientele facing various mental health challenges, such as anxiety, depression, ADHD, and more. You will predominantly work with adults and adolescents, with an exciting goal of extending our services across all age groups in the future.

    What We’re Looking For:

    • Active Board Certification as a Psychiatric Mental Health Nurse Practitioner

    • Master’s degree in Nursing, including prescriptive authority

    • Familiarity with AdvancedMD (AMD) EMR is a plus

    • Experience of at least three years in a relevant role is advantageous

    • Must hold a valid license to practice in South Carolina

    • Participation in our in-house training on ADHD treatment standards and guidelines is required, culminating in a certification exam. All new hires will engage with ADHD clients but there are no quotas for treatment or prescriptions.

    Compensation and Benefits:

    • This fee-for-service position offers a salary range of $130,000 to $187,000 annually, based on 25-35 clinical hours per week.

    Your Role Will Include:

    • Conducting thorough psychiatric assessments and evaluations through a continuous telemedicine platform

    • Prescribing medications to alleviate mental health issues, as appropriate

    • Collaborating with clients to develop personalized care plans

    • Completing necessary documentation and utilizing assessment tools for client progress

    • Adhering to Thriveworks’ Clinical Practice Guidelines

    • Consulting with our Regional Clinic Directors and team members regarding client programs and services across various locations
